WebSep 9, 2024 · With an inline, place the muzzle in the bucket of water. With a traditional rifle you’ll place the breech end in the water. Very Simple Soak a patch in the water and wrap it around the jag and begin swabbing the bore. As you push the patch all the way through and then pull the rod back up, you will begin to siphon the hot water up into the barrel. WebProtective measures should be taken to allow you to practice firing without damaging the nipple, flint, or frizzen. Protecting a Percussion Lock Firearm: Place a rubber faucet washer over the nipple so that the hammer strikes the washer instead of the nipple itself. Protecting a Flintlock Firearm: Replace the flint with a piece of hard wood.
